cookutils rev 784

cooker.cgi: avoid reload with recook
author Pascal Bellard <pascal.bellard@slitaz.org>
date Sun Dec 06 17:50:32 2015 +0100 (2015-12-06)
parents ffda920a7d6f
children 256af05e0925
files web/cooker.cgi
line diff
     1.1 --- a/web/cooker.cgi	Sun Dec 06 12:02:31 2015 +0100
     1.2 +++ b/web/cooker.cgi	Sun Dec 06 17:50:32 2015 +0100
     1.3 @@ -25,6 +25,13 @@
     1.4  export TZ=$(cat /etc/TZ)
     1.5  
     1.6  case "$QUERY_STRING" in
     1.7 +recook=*)
     1.8 +	echo ${QUERY_STRING#recook=} >> $CACHE/recook-packages
     1.9 +	cat <<EOT
    1.10 +Location: $HTTP_REFERER
    1.11 +
    1.12 +EOT
    1.13 +	exit ;;
    1.14  poke)
    1.15  	touch $CACHE/cooker-request
    1.16  	cat <<EOT
    1.17 @@ -373,9 +380,6 @@
    1.18  		fi ;;
    1.19  
    1.20  	*)
    1.21 -		case "${QUERY_STRING}" in
    1.22 -		recook=*) echo ${QUERY_STRING#recook=} >> $CACHE/recook-packages ;;
    1.23 -		esac
    1.24  		# We may have a toolchain.cgi script for cross cooker's
    1.25  		if [ -f "toolchain.cgi" ]; then
    1.26  			toolchain='toolchain.cgi'